Description:
SOFTCONSULTS is providing cloud-based ERP solutions since 1999. Our Project Team collaborates with clients to create business-fit solutions for ERP Deployment, Project management and Planning, Technical Support, Data Migration, and QA Testing.
Using Xamarin, you will create and manage cross-platform mobile applications. This is a fantastic chance to work on cutting-edge projects in a creative, fast-paced setting.
The primary duties include:
- Write well-written code that satisfies functional requirements, is manageable, and enhances user experience.
- Determine the technical course and ensure adherence to the coding standards and architectural principles.
- Determine overall structure of the application, select appropriate APIs, and design scalable and maintainable solutions.
- Address problems that come up during the development process and resolve technical challenges using expertise to come up with practical solutions to meet project deadlines.
- Closely collaborate with team members to convert project specifications into technical solutions.
- Ensure that code reviews are conducted regularly as part of the development process to maintain code quality, identify bugs, and prevent technical debt.
Requirements:
- Bachelor's Degree in Computer Science, Computer Engineering or equivalent technical Degree.
- Minimum 2 year of experience with .Net Framework and Xamarin.
- Ability to design software using industry standard technologies.
- Excellent problem-solving abilities, including the capacity to effectively debug and troubleshoot issues in application.
- Thorough knowledge of .Net Framework, data structures, OOP and algorithms.
- Strong understanding of unit tests, performing code reviews, and ensuring the quality and reliability of code.
- Eager to pick up new skills, and aware of developments in the field and upcoming technology.
- Knowledge of mobile development for both the iOS and Android platforms, as well as platform-specific APIs.
- Have the ability to perform comfortably in a fast-paced, deadline-driven work environment.
- Proficient in both written and verbal communication.